Transaction 12a3e801eed5097c699056bb38fa8057143d14fb8a770067424cf437b35d7a0f

1 Input
2 Outputs
  • 12a3e801eed5097c699056bb38fa8057143d14fb8a770067424cf437b35d7a0f:0
  • value  270960151898
    address  mrZ1DBGmwkrsnPGmP93RHsPeAfvWQQpvLM
  • 12a3e801eed5097c699056bb38fa8057143d14fb8a770067424cf437b35d7a0f:1
  • value  131567309
    address  mrCDrCybB6J1vRfbwM5hemdJz73FwDBC8r